    It wasn't long before they were joined by yet another stallion. Desirea watched him curiously as he approached. Her face was soft and mild, her eyes bright with interest in this new turn of events. She'd never seen an equine with such a magnificent pair of wings (at least as far as she remembered). The way he slung one gorgeously-feathered appendage over Zaravich was charming and strange.

    But as she turned her head to admire the approaching stallion, Desirea happened to catch Szeth's deadly glare.  There was so much hatred and disdain in his eyes that she immediately felt a chill of fear pass through her.  Desirea turned her eyes back to the newest addition to the group, studying him carefully to see what unforgivable trait she had missed.  Glancing him over, however, she could see nothing obvious.  What had put the spotted stallion on edge?  It made her nervous.  What did he know about this new arrival that she did not?

    Desirea gave Phaedrus, as he was called, a polite smile; but it was obvious now that she was quite unsure of herself.  "It's a pleasure to meet you, Phaedrus," she said softly.  He seemed so at ease and comfortable, aside from the gently protective touch of his wing on Zaravich's back -- but stallions were meant to be protective of their mares, and she could find no obvious fault in his posture.

    Desirea realized that the time had come for her to make a decision, so that everyone could be on their way.  It did no good to stand around in the middle of nowhere making small talk, especially when one member of the group was obviously ill-at-ease.  Even aside from that, the winged stallion had begun to glance around, as if in his mind he had already abandoned them for more interesting prospects.  

    The little roan mare glanced between Zaravich and Szeth one more time before taking a shy step toward the spotted stallion.  Their shoulders brushed, and she felt her skin warm at the unexpected touch. "I'd be happy to join you, Szeth, if you don't mind."  She smiled bashfully at him before turning her gaze back toward the other two equine.

    "I hope to meet up with you again Zaravich, Phaedrus."  Her eyes were bright, despite the uncertainty she felt in the presence of this new stallion.  The fact that Zaravich was so comfortable with him made her feel a little more at ease; regardless, she would certainly pepper Szeth with questions as soon as they were out of earshot.  She turned one more time to Zaravich, feeling guilty that she had been put into such an awkward situation.  Her gaze was apologetic, but she still smiled adoringly at the lovely mare.  "Thank you so much for your kindness, Zaravich."
